Most people today suffer from dental decay at some point in their lives. Enamel is the outermost hard part of the teeth, and it shields the innermost layers from infections caused by harmful bacteria. Tooth enamel decay is brought about by enamel erosion in or around the teeth. It can be avoided if you consume the right food and drinks and practice excellent oral care.
